To protect your investment when letting a furnished apartment, it is wise to provide the tenant with an itemized list of the things included in the flat lease. Be quite specific; list the amount of plates, bowls, and cups, for instance, and describe things as accurately as possible. List the replacement cost of each thing if the piece is taken by the renter with him when he moves out, or if it's damaged beyond ordinary wear and tear. Signal if the tenant will must pay you for the things, or if the replacement cost will be taken out of the security deposit. Have the tenant sign a copy of this stock so there aren't any surprises when the rental comes to a finish.

In addition to or instead of a higher rent for a furnished apartment, you could request a higher security deposit on the lease. Collecting more money up front can assist you to cover the costs of replacing or fixing the things in the furnished apartment if they may be damaged. Check with your state laws before collecting the security deposit, though. Some states have laws regulating what landlords can charge and security deposits. If you do not wish to contain it in the security deposit, you could also charge another cleaning fee for the rental, to pay for the costs of cleaning curtains, bedding, furniture and other things.

Whether you want to hire one or own a vacation rental, it really is important to shield yourself with a contract that clearly lays out the duties and duties of all parties.
Times and the dates of arrival and departure are spelled out in great specificity in the vacation rental lease. Vacationers are coming and going every week--sometimes every few days--and the units must be cleaned in between stays. To avoid vacancy between stays, the time between check in and checkout is normally a comparatively brief window. And because some vacationers rely on air transportation, there are occasionally last minute requests to arrive or depart late or early. It's, therefore, important to contain contingency requests in the lease, signaling both a procedure and a cost to alter agreed upon strategies.
